What Are Business Insights?

Business insights refer to the meaningful interpretations derived from data analysis that help organizations make informed strategic decisions. Instead of relying on fragmented data or intuition, businesses use insights to uncover patterns, trends, and risks that influence outcomes.

These insights are typically generated from a combination of sources such as financial data, industry reports, market trends, and company performance metrics. When analyzed correctly, they provide a clear picture of both internal performance and external market conditions.

The Role of Company Insights in Strategic Decision-Making

While business insights offer a broader market perspective, company insights focus on specific organizations, including customers, suppliers, and competitors. These insights include:

  • Financial strength and stability

  • Payment behavior and creditworthiness

  • Ownership structure and corporate linkages

  • Industry positioning and operational scale

For executives in the UAE, where business ecosystems are highly interconnected, understanding company-level data is essential for making decisions related to partnerships, vendor selection, and market expansion.

How Business Insights Help Evaluate Market Opportunities

Entering a new market or expanding within an existing one requires a deep understanding of industry dynamics. Business insights provide:

1. Market Trends and Demand Analysis

Organizations can analyze industry growth patterns, demand fluctuations, and emerging sectors to identify where opportunities lie.

2. Customer Segmentation

Insights help businesses understand target audiences, purchasing behavior, and regional preferences, enabling more effective market entry strategies.

3. Risk Assessment

Market insights highlight potential risks such as economic instability, sector-specific challenges, or regulatory complexities, allowing businesses to plan accordingly.

With the right data, companies can move beyond guesswork and make calculated expansion decisions.

Gaining Competitive Advantage Through Company Insights

Understanding competitors is a key component of business success. Company insights enable organizations to:

  • Benchmark performance against competitors

  • Identify gaps in the market

  • Analyze competitor strengths and weaknesses

  • Track changes in competitor strategies

For example, if a competitor is expanding rapidly or showing strong financial performance, it may indicate a growing market segment worth exploring. Conversely, identifying financially unstable competitors can signal potential risks in partnerships or supply chains.

Improving Financial Decision-Making

Financial decisions are at the core of every business strategy. Business insights provide executives with a clearer understanding of financial risks and opportunities.

Credit and Risk Evaluation

By analyzing company credit profiles and payment histories, businesses can assess the reliability of potential partners and customers.

Investment Planning

Insights into industry performance and company stability help organizations allocate resources more effectively and prioritize high-return opportunities.

Cash Flow Management

Understanding payment trends and financial behavior supports better forecasting and improved liquidity management.

With accurate financial insights, companies can avoid costly mistakes and build more resilient strategies.

Supporting Better Partnership and Vendor Decisions

Choosing the right partners is critical for long-term success. Company insights help businesses evaluate:

  • Supplier reliability and performance

  • Financial stability of partners

  • Historical payment behavior

  • Corporate structure and ownership

This level of visibility reduces the risk of working with unreliable entities and ensures stronger, more sustainable business relationships.
